TLDR
This diff adds documentation to the Remote Code Execution risk for
Dataframe.queryandcomputation.evalwith the same wording used in Dataframe.evalDetails
The Dataframe.query function is internally calling Dataframe.eval here passing the
exprparameter.Dataframe.eval is correctly warning in the documentation that this could lead to Code execution risk.
This is possible because using the
@syntax we can access local variables and by referencing the imported pandas library we can get theos.systemfunction thanks toosbeing imported inside compat/init.py. In this way passing something like@pd.compat.os.system('whoami')to theexprparameter ofDataframe.querywe can achieve code execution.However in Dataframe.query documentation we do not surface this risk we only point out that pandas.eval is called but also there we do not warn about any code execution risks.
The vulnerable code I found and that also surprised the developer who wrote it of the code execution risk can be summarized in UserControlled input flowing into the DataFrame.query expr value similarly to
Calling this api with data:
https://www.example.com?filter=@pd.compat.os.system('whoami')
will allow code execution.
